On-call basics for Quillmere ingress. The Bramleigh load balancer checks /health on each pod every 5s; two failures pull the pod, one success restores it. If all pods fail checks simultaneously, suspect the shared config store, not the pods. Check the LB dashboard first, then pod logs. Manual drain is available via the fleet API. Probing the fleet API from your laptop requires the key that follows.

API key for yahig-tadup: kto7_ubizbYm

Handover note — Crumbwheel order cutoffs.

Welcome aboard. The bakery cutoff rule in Crumbwheel closes same-day orders at 14:00 local to each storefront, not UTC — this has bitten us twice. Holiday overrides live in the calendar service and take precedence silently, so always check there first when a cutoff looks wrong. To unlock the calendar service's admin console after a restart, enter the recovery passphrase below.

vault phrase of bagap-bahaf = silion-pelox-sorox-casdor-quenwyn-fraax-eliox-praael-kelion-quenvan-kasox-rusael-norius-belvan

- [ ] Step 7: Archive cold storage buckets (Glacierline tier). Confirm both ceremony witnesses are present, verify bucket manifests match the Oxbow ledger, then seal the archive key shares. Plugin authors may observe but not handle shares. Once sealed, the archive index itself is encrypted and can only be reopened with the passphrase below.

vault phrase of badup-hahig = tamael-aldael-kelmir-istael-fenok-istwyn-tamius-jorath-oliion